The incumbent will be responsible for the management of a large scale education development project and will oversee programme implementation in three provinces across South Africa in collaboration with the senior programme manager and programme director. 

Required qualifications

A Bachelor’s degree in Education, Development or related field (a postgraduate qualification is an added advantage) 

Knowledge, experience and skills required 
  • Knowledge and experience in the education and/or development sectors
  • Extensive experience in and proven track record of managing and supporting large- scale, complex interventions and extensive
  • A minimum of five years’ experience in high-level project management, including managing high-level budgets and the performance of project staff 
  • Excellent leadership, interpersonal, planning and organisational skills
  • High-level communication skills, both written and verbal
  • Fluency in isiZulu, siSwati, Setswana and Afrikaans will be an added advantage 
  • Ability to establish and maintain relationships with project partners, clients and stakeholders at all levels
  • Ability to problem-solve and multi-task
  • Computer literacy (MS Office package)
  • A valid and unendorsed code 08 driver’s license

The individual should be highly motivated to make a difference in the education sector through the work JET does.

Key Performance Areas

The project manager is expected to ensure effective project implementation by:

  • Ensuring targets are met
  • Managing and monitoring the project budget
  • Managing the performance of the project staff 
  • Overseeing monitoring and evaluation of project implementation
  • Managing information and reporting     
  • Ensuring effective communication and flow of information 
  • Developing and maintaining relationships 
  • Managing diverse group of highly skilled team members
  • Working closely with the project director and senior project manager to strategize and implement agreed programmatic activities
  • Managing and evaluating identified implementation partners and working collaboratively with the various curriculum and infrastructure specialists 

The project manager will work closely with and report directly to the senior programme manager and must be willing to travel.
